We Have Moved!

Pampered Paws has found a bigger building for our little four (and three) legged friends. We have moved to the old Petron Building on Hwy. 124. It is the big green building across 124 from the Papa's Place restaurant. For those who have lived in Winnie for a while it was the John Deere building many many years ago.
We have more playrooms, an inside play area, a bigger outside play area and more kennel space. We are so excited to be able to expand our business and provide a bigger place to take care of your family members.
